What to check before for buildings with rent-stabilized apartments near landmarks in NYC

  • Expect rent-stabilized apartments that offer protection against excessive rent increases.
  • Verify the specific regulations and eligibility for rent stabilization in each building.
  • Confirm any fees related to application processes or security deposits.
  • Check lease terms for duration and renewal policies to avoid surprises.
  • Inquire about amenities and maintenance practices to ensure they meet your needs.
